Transaction d21c16752ac3a196c76251c1d82a224fade026f704bd6a6eb11775313278314a
1 Input
2 Outputs
- d21c16752ac3a196c76251c1d82a224fade026f704bd6a6eb11775313278314a:0
- d21c16752ac3a196c76251c1d82a224fade026f704bd6a6eb11775313278314a:1
value 99672948
address 1PnPoV2rwacWTdfmWKigxywexiXVSbTFLt
value 4133040
address 1AUiUpHAxfCi6h21a7X3Lpv8hNVwkKn29P